Job Description
Join a dedicated healthcare team in the heart of the Midwest region, where compassionate service and patient support are top priorities. As an Appointment Access Specialist, you will play a vital role in ensuring patients receive timely care by managing appointment scheduling and addressing inquiries with empathy and professionalism. General Summary This role involves supporting patient access by efficiently handling incoming calls, providing accurate information, and assisting with appointment coordination. You will be a key point of contact, delivering respectful and compassionate service while maintaining precise documentation and meeting quality standards.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Promptly answer incoming calls, document and route messages appropriately. Assist patients with scheduling and provide clear, accurate information. Represent the organization professionally through phone, electronic, and written communication. Maintain accurate patient records in electronic systems to support continuity of care. Communicate detailed information clearly to ensure proper scheduling and follow-up. Resolve patient questions and concerns by identifying needs, offering solutions, and escalating issues when necessary. Utilize de-escalation and service recovery techniques to support distressed callers and maintain satisfaction. Contribute to call center performance goals and participate in ongoing training while ensuring confidentiality and HIPAA compliance. Education High school diploma or GED required. Post-secondary education in healthcare or related fields is preferred.
